Tenn. Comp. R. & Regs. 0780-08-02-.01 - DEFINITION
(1) Collectable lighter means a lighter that
has vintage, antique, collector, or limited edition quality in accordance with
the production guidelines of a brand name lighter manufacturer. A collectable
lighter is not prohibited for sale if it is made before January 1, 1980 or is
considered vintage, antique, collector, or limited edition in accordance with
the production guidelines of a brand name lighter manufacturer.
Notes
Authority: T.C.A. §§ 4-5-201, et seq., and 47-18-129(e).
